    So I set up my phone with an MS account, and even though I use Outlook the mail app has a Hotmail icon. It's a small thing, but it's bothering me. Is there any way to change it? I tried adding an Outlook account (really the same account I used in the beginning) to the phone and that got me the right icon but there's no way to delete the original so I was left with redundant information. Like I said, they're the same account.

    I'd like to only have one MS account attached to my phone and also have the Outlook icon on my email app. Has anyone else had any luck having their cake and eating it too?

    If your MS acct has been converted to an Outlook acct (where the primary address is now @outlook.com) the default mail image should be the Outlook icon. If you want it badly enough you may want to do a hard reset and sign in with the Outlook credentials instead (if they are in fact the same account your apps and backups should work fine)

    You can still convert your account to an Outlook.com account. It preserves your purchases and account information, and even gives you your old live.com as an alias so people with your old address can still send you stuff while you transition to the new address. The only catch is it does require a one time hard reset and repeat of the initial settings on your Windows Phone, but you can restore your backed up data after the reset. I had a live.com account and upgraded it to outlook.com when I got my Lumia. It worked great, I even got the exact same address as my outlook.com address.
